Jailed former principal accountant Kazinda seeks sh148m in legal costs

Ordering the IGG to pay costs to Kazinda, the justices of the regional court found that the country’s ombudsman does not personally fall within the purview of the Treaty for the establishment of East African Community and thus could not be added as party to the reference that was filed by Kazinda before the regional court.
